Storm Damages Homes in Northwest Georgia Town

Authorities say about five homes have been heavily damaged by a thunderstorm in the northwest Georgia town of Ringgold.

No injuries were reported from the Monday night storm.

The Chattanooga Times Free Press reports that belongings from the homes were scattered around Morning Glory Drive, and the owners of the homes were evacuated.

Catoosa County sheriff’s officials and construction crews were assessing the damage Tuesday morning.

Ringgold is about 15 miles south of Chattanooga, Tennessee.
